
Understanding Reflexology
Reflexology is a natural healing technique that involves applying pressure to specific points on the feet, hands, or ears to promote relaxation and overall well-being. At Happy Feet Reflexology in Freehold, NJ, this practice is used to stimulate energy flow, relieve stress, and improve circulation. Many people seek reflexology as a complementary therapy to support pain relief, better sleep, and enhanced mental clarity.
How Reflexology Works
A reflexologist applies targeted pressure to reflex points, which correspond to different organs and body systems. The goal is to restore balance and encourage the bodyβs natural healing process. Reflexology vs. Traditional Massage: Whatβs the Difference?
Reflexology is not just a foot massageβit is a therapeutic method that targets specific pressure points to influence internal organs and nerve pathways. Unlike traditional massage, which focuses on muscles and soft tissue, reflexology works on the nervous system and energy flow to enhance overall wellness.
